<h1>New Guidelines for Indians Lending to NRI/PIO Relatives: Interest-Free, USD 200k Cap, One-Year Maturity, Specific Usage Only.</h1> The circular addresses the guidelines for resident individuals in India lending in Rupees to their non-resident Indian (NRI) or Person of Indian Origin (PIO) close relatives. It permits such loans under specific conditions: loans must be interest-free with a minimum maturity of one year, within the USD 200,000 limit under the Liberalised Remittance Scheme, and used for personal or business purposes in India, excluding prohibited activities like real estate or agricultural businesses. Loan amounts must be credited to the NRO account of the NRI/PIO and cannot be remitted outside India. Repayment should occur through specified channels. Amendments to relevant regulations are forthcoming.
